Design Tips for Using Abandone Musstare Effectively
When working with Abandone Musstare, it’s important to consider how it will look in different contexts. For example, while it’s great for headlines and short phrases, it might not be the best choice for long paragraphs of text. That’s why pairing it with a complementary sans serif or serif font is a smart move for body copy.
If you’re using this font on printed materials, make sure to test it at different sizes. The font maintains its clarity even when scaled down, which is essential for small labels or tags. On digital platforms, it looks just as good on mobile screens as it does on desktops, ensuring a consistent brand experience across devices.
Another thing to keep in mind is the font’s file formats and licensing. Since Abandone Musstare is a commercial font, it’s important to ensure that you have the right license to use it on merchandise, templates, or client work. Checking the included styles, ligatures, and alternates can also help you get the most out of the font for your specific needs.
